Seongwan Jang is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Organic Chemistry and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Seongwan Jang has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 340 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Materials Chemistry, 9 papers in Organic Chemistry and 2 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Seongwan Jang’s work include Click Chemistry and Applications (3 papers), Nanomaterials for catalytic reactions (3 papers) and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(2 papers). Seongwan Jang is often cited by papers focused on Click Chemistry and Applications (3 papers), Nanomaterials for catalytic reactions (3 papers) and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(2 papers). Seongwan Jang collaborates with scholars based in South Korea and China. Seongwan Jang's co-authors include Kang Hyun Park, Hyunje Woo, Sang Hoon Joo, Sungkyun Park, Hyuntae Kang, K.H. Kim, J.H. Park, Myung Chang Kang, C. Kim and Jongnam Park and has published in prestigious journals such as Chemistry - A European Journal, Molecules and Surface and Coatings Technology.
